FYI, ladies and gents, the change from "Zoro" to "Zolo" wasn't made to kiss up to 4Kids.
Did it ever occur to any of you dimwits still complaining about it that "Lupin Syndrome" had a part to play in this?
Zorro...was one of my favorite TV shows when Disney Channel aired the old reruns. Almost reminiscent of shonen manga in and of itself, the series was based on an old series of novels featuring the masked hero (which, ironically, were written by an American).
It helps that "Zorro" is Spanish for "fox".
But anyway, you might remember that America was denied "Lupin the 3rd" for years, or at the very least the "Lupin" name, because Monkey Punch's original manga was inspired by the fictional exploits of Arsene Lupin, a gentleman thief who also originated in novels. It's the same reason why the Hayao Miyazaki-inspired "Great Detective Holmes" series became "Sherlock Hound"; because the estate of Sir Arthur Conan Doyle had a problem with the use of the name.
In brief: which would you prefer? Keep "Zoro" and have the whole matter tangled up in legal rights proceedings for years? Or fudge a single letter and keep One Piece coming?
